Northwest Africa 14225
Basic information Name: Northwest Africa 14225
     This is an OFFICIAL meteorite name.
Abbreviation: NWA 14225
Observed fall: No
Year found: 2021
Country: (Northwest Africa)
Mass:help 194.7 g
Classification
  history:
Meteoritical Bulletin:  MB 110  (2022)  LL6
Recommended:  LL6    [explanation]

Place of purchase:Talsint, Morocco
Date:P 2021 June
Mass (g):194.7
Pieces:1
Class:LL6
Shock stage:S4
Weathering grade:W1
Fayalite (mol%):27.7±0.1 (n=4)
Ferrosilite (mol%):22.9±0.2 (n=4)
Wollastonite (mol%):1.6±0.3 (n=4)
Classifier:A. Greshake, MNB
Type spec mass (g):30.5
Type spec location:MNB
Main mass:Noreddine Azelmat
Comments:Grayish rock with minor fusion crust. Plag grain size is ~30 µm; black shock melt veins.; submitted by Ansgar Greshake
